基于PID算法的水产养殖水质监控系统研究
随着社会经济的发展,水产养殖由传统的捕捞方式向着工厂化养殖方式转变。水产品的质量和经济效益与养殖环境的水质有着极其密切的联系,物联网近几年发展的十分迅速,以物联网技术为核心的水产养殖监控系统的研究变得尤为重要。针对目前出现的养殖场受外界因素影响水质波动过大的问题,研究了一套基于PID(Proportional Integral Derivative)算法的水产养殖水质监控系统。该系统将养殖区域水质中的溶解氧、p H值、温度三种主要因素作为监测对象,溶解氧的浓度作为调控对象,主要由三部分组成:感知层、传输层、应用层。(1)感知层由三个终端节点组成:分别为溶解氧终端节点、p H终端节点、温度终端节点。主要起到水质因素采集、溶解氧浓度的调控及超过阈值时进行报警的作用。(2)传输层采用LoRa(Long Range)无线传感网络,采用ESP32Wi-Fi模块个ATK-LoRa-01通信模块作为主控机节点,将感知层的采集数据进行汇总传输至应用层。(3)应用层实现各参数的监测和分项显示,服务器与APP(Applicaton)进行数据互传,APP通过传输层将控制指令下放至感知层,控制增氧泵和蜂鸣器的运行。目前,本系统在模拟水产养殖环境下调试成功,实现了对水体的溶解氧、p H值及温度三种因素的实时监测,对水体溶氧进行了调控,同时对控制算法进行了仿真比较,得出本系统的模糊PID控制算法能够更快速的趋于稳定,而且基本无超调,总体达到预期结果,解决了当溶解氧的浓度在阈值左右时,造成的增氧泵反复启停,使用寿命缩短的问题。并根据系统开发成本低、实用性强的特点,该系统适用于水产工厂化养殖方面。
- 作者:
- 朱家玮
- 学位授予单位:
- 塔里木大学
- 授予学位:
- 硕士
- 学位年度:
- 2021年
- 导师姓名:
- 孟洪兵
- 中图分类号:
- S959
- 关键词:
- PID控制;LoRa通信;水产养殖;物联网
-